Clay roof leak repair services focus on identifying and fixing leaks in roofs constructed with clay tiles. These services typically involve inspecting the roof to locate the source of leaks, which can be caused by cracked, broken, or displaced tiles, as well as damaged flashing or deteriorated mortar. Once the problem areas are identified, contractors may replace broken tiles, reseal flashing, or apply specialized patches to prevent water from seeping through. Proper repair not only stops ongoing leaks but also helps prevent further damage to the roof structure and interior spaces.
This service addresses common issues such as cracked or broken tiles, which often occur due to weather exposure or age. Leaks can also stem from deteriorated flashing around roof penetrations like vents or chimneys, as well as from loose or displaced tiles resulting from wind or other impacts. Repairing these problems helps to eliminate water intrusion, protect the home's interior from water damage, and maintain the roof's overall integrity. Prompt attention to leaks can also prevent mold growth, wood rot, and costly structural repairs down the line.

What are common signs of a leaking clay roof? Indicators include water stains on ceilings, visible dampness or mold, missing or damaged clay tiles, and water dripping inside during rain.
Can clay roof leaks be repaired without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many leaks can be addressed through targeted repairs such as replacing damaged tiles or sealing cracks, avoiding the need for full roof replacement.
What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form for clay roof leaks? They often perform tile replacement, sealing of cracks, flashing repairs, and waterproofing to stop leaks and prevent future damage.
Is it necessary to inspect a clay roof after heavy storms or hail? Regular inspections after severe weather events can help identify potential damage early and ensure leaks are addressed promptly.
How can homeowners prevent future clay roof leaks? Proper maintenance, routine inspections, and timely repairs of damaged tiles or flashing can help minimize the risk of leaks over time.
